This BusinessWeek article reports there are more ebooks (26,976) than games (25,33) selling at the Apple App Store. Grain of salt: Doesn’t mean ebooks are selling better. But there’s a market for it!

This idea will require a familiarity with affiliate marketing in general and specific programs whose affiliates you’ll be “serving” in particular.

Some programs just aren’t all that good at providing their affiliates with good marketing and promotional resources beyond some banners and a few token text ads and email templates, if that. Giveaway ebooks that could go viral? Yeah right.
